Calculations:
Total Power drawn by the circuit = 6 watts
Voltage of the circuit = 12 volts
P = V I COS Ø
P = V I 1 (Assuming COS Ø = 1 for resistive load)
Current in the circuit (I) = Power (P) / (Voltage (V) x COS Ø)
= 6 W / (12 V 1) = 0.5 A.
Fuse rating of the circuit = rounding off the current to the nearest 5
= 5A (Normally fuses are available in the ratings of 5A/10A/15A
